The family especially the elders are wary of going too far just for a dinner. Thus, this is one of the few peculiar moments where we have decided to venture further North to try a new Chinese restaurant. We were probably enchanted by Sha Tin Courtyard Chinese Bistro's facade.
Upon stepping in, we were more enamored by Sha Tin's interiors. The harmonious combination of red seats, lanterns and artificial greens reminded us of the lantern festival scenes from Chinese shows. Even the busy sound of the restaurant exudes a festive ambiance.
Now, these big red linen covered round tables were the much familiar set up for a Chinese restaurant.
While waiting, we were served some complimentary hot tea and peanuts. This is also customary for Chinese restaurants of this type.
Food
As expected, the menu offers both ala carte and set menu. For Chinese restaurants that we regularly visit, we usually take the set menu and the adjust a few dishes therein based on the advisement of the manager. However, since this is our first time to try Sha Tin, we opted to go for the ala carte so we can try the dishes that interested us.

Of course, when you hear Anilao Batangas, the first thing that comes to mind is snorkeling and scuba diving as the area has one of the most amazing marine life in the country.
Actually, Saltitude Dive & Beach Resort is the new and revamped Anilao Beach Club. It now has quirky-decorated themes rooms which represent activities you can do by the beach.
The place has become fresh, hip, colorful and fun! It pioneers its own activities such as coastal clean-ups and Saturday night beach BBQ during summertime.
Brunchin' at the Beach
Last August 17, 2019, Saltitude just launched its Brunchin' at the Beach which is available every Saturday from 9:30 am to 12:30 pm.
Even if you're not staying at Saltitude, you can avail of the Brunchin' at the Beach for a drop-in rate of 699 php. The rate is inclusive of the unlimited drinks with a choice of Infused Water, Orange Juice or Brewed Barako Coffee.

The Century Seafood Restaurant: Chinese Lauriat Dinner (Century Park Hotel Malate)
Malate, Manila, Metro Manila, Philippines
I've been to The Century Seafood Restaurant many times. and their usually during occasions: birthdays, weddings, baptism...
It has a huge space so it's quite ideal for any party.
Aside from the dining areas, it has private rooms like this one where my Uncle's birthday was held.
Food
If it's Chinese restaurant, no doubt food would be serve lauriat style. And, when you've dined at the same place, you kind of know the items that's typical for table sets too. Anyways, starting of with the
Assorted Barbecue Combination. I love these. In fact, I love these so much that I'd secretly feel lucky if I'm seated in a unfilled table so I can have more of these. =p
I'm aware that there's a lot of issues with sharks. But, the Crabmeat Sharks Fin Soup is already ordered so I consumed it praying it's not real shark fin (you know they now use jellies and stuff) because it is delicious!
You can't go wrong with Fried Prawn with Garlic and Pepper. Any cuisine, any version of this being cooked is always good.
The Abalone Mushroom with Black Mushroom is my favorite because I'm a sucker for mushroom.
The Scallop with Black Moss Hair and Broccoli is another favorite of mine. Aside from the taste, I have to admit the rarity and price of scallop is another factor that I look forward to having it each time.
Though loaded with cholesterol, I love Fried Pigeon so much that I even enjoy eating its brain. =)
The Steamed Crab is another sure fire hit among the crowd of young and old. With a crab of this size, anyone wouldn't mind getting their hands dirty.
In every dinner I've been, one dish that will always be scraped clean to the bones is Steamed Lapu-Lapu.
My mom is a big fan of Chinese noodles, there are days at home that she'd ask us to buy her some or her some delivered. But, I'm personally not a fan of Birthday Noodles. I have my share as a contribution for the long life of the celebrants though.
Steamed Birthday Buns with sweet paste is something I've wanna have as much as I want. But, on is enough to make me feel full.
The Tapioca in Coconut Milk is not as popular as the Mango Sago. Some kids don't even want to have it.
